如何获取file的名字

时间:2025-03-27 13:43:30 个性网名

在Java中,你可以使用`java.io.File`类的`getName()`方法来获取文件名。以下是一个简单的示例代码:

```java

import java.io.File;

public class GetFileNameExample {

public static void main(String[] args) {

// 创建一个File对象

File file = new File("C:/path/to/file.txt");

// 获取文件名称

String fileName = file.getName();

// 打印文件名称

System.out.println(fileName);

}

}

```

在这个例子中,我们首先创建了一个`File`对象来表示文件,然后通过调用`getName()`方法获取文件名,并使用`System.out.println()`打印出来。

如果你使用的是Python,可以使用`os.path.basename()`函数或者`pathlib`模块的`Path`类的`name`属性来获取文件名。以下是Python中的示例代码:

使用`os.path.basename()`函数:

```python

import os

file_path = '/path/to/your/file.txt'

file_name = os.path.basename(file_path)

print(file_name) 输出: file.txt

```

使用`pathlib`模块:

```python

from pathlib import Path

file_path = '/path/to/your/file.txt'

file_name = Path(file_path).name

print(file_name) 输出: file.txt

```

这些方法都可以帮助你获取文件名,具体使用哪个方法取决于你的编程语言和环境。